But it’s the GRIIIx, first launched in 2021, that’s particularly superb for watch pictures—because of the addition of a 40mm focal lens, which is much better for capturing close-ups than the 28mm lens on the GRIII. “If you’re trying to do watch stuff, to me the X is the only real option,” says Pulvirent. By swapping out the lens, Ricoh by accident unlocked an entire new viewers.
The gospel of the Ricoh GRIIIx has unfold rapidly by means of the watch world. “The Ricoh really got on my radar when I visited [watch retailer] Derek Mon earlier this year at Carat & Co. and he wouldn’t shut up about it,” Traina says. Mon tells me that the primary particular person he noticed utilizing it was Kong. “It’s funny to know that I influenced others,” Kong says, “but someone else actually influenced me first: photographer-turned-watch brand founder Ming Thein. Not only did he teach me most of what I know about watch photography, but he’s also one of the most discerning people I’ve ever met. He picked up the IIIx soon after its release in 2021 and raved to me about its output.”
Thein is the founding father of the deeply inventive model Ming however, like Kong, received his begin capturing watches. It is smart that so many individuals within the business would observe his lead. Thein has been utilizing some variation of the GR digicam since 2006, he tells me, however he at all times wished a model with an extended focal size to shoot structure, posed portraits, and watches. “The 40mm GRIIIx was perfect for that,” he says.
The Ricoh’s most successful high quality is its portability. “It can fit in your pocket,” says Steinberg. “And I mean really fit in your pocket, without a squeeze.” Traina, Pulvirent, and Barr all liked that it was the one digicam they wanted to carry to Watches and Wonders. At final yr’s truthful, Barr had an appointment with one luxurious model whose reps had been large followers of his luxurious pictures. As a crew lugged out suitcases filled with digicam tools from the earlier appointment, Barr strolled in carrying simply his Ricoh. “They looked at me like, ‘Wait, what the fuck? This guy is shooting off this little tiny camera?’” Barr says.
“The best camera you can have is the one you can keep with you,” says Mark Cho, the co-founder of The Armoury and one other longtime Ricoh proprietor. “And the Ricoh is without a doubt the best size-to-picture-quality camera you can find.”
